Hidden House Vermin



Are you knowledgeable about the concealed house bugs that may be prowling in your home? While you might be vigilant concerning common pests like ants or crawlers, there are various other sly trespassers that could be causing damage behind the scenes.



One such pest is the silverfish, a little pest that prospers in wet and dark environments like basements and restrooms. These parasites can damage books, apparel, and even wallpaper, making them a nuisance to manage.

An additional concealed parasite to keep an eye out for is the carpeting beetle. These little bugs feed upon a range of products located in homes, such as rugs, clothing, and upholstery. Their larvae can cause substantial damages if left unattended, making it crucial to address any type of indicators of infestation quickly.

Furthermore, mold mites are frequently neglected yet can suggest a wetness issue in your house. These small creatures feed upon mold and can get worse allergic reactions for delicate individuals. Maintaining your home completely dry and well-ventilated can help prevent these pests from settling in your home.

Unwelcome Intruders



Unwanted intruders can disrupt your family tranquility and cause damages otherwise taken care of without delay. While bugs like rats and roaches are commonly recognized, other lesser-known trespassers like silverfish and rug beetles can likewise create chaos in your home. Silverfish are small, wingless bugs that flourish in moist areas and eat starchy products like paper and glue, causing damage to publications, wallpaper, and clothes. Rug beetles, on the other hand, feast on a range of things such as rugs, apparel, and upholstery, bring about expensive damages if left uncontrolled.

These unwelcome burglars not only damage your items yet can additionally position health dangers. Rodents and roaches, for instance, can spread out illness through their droppings and pee, contaminating surfaces and food. Silverfish and carpet beetles can cause allergic reactions in some individuals, causing skin irritability and respiratory system issues.

To stop these intruders from taking control of your home, it's vital to maintain sanitation, seal entrance points, and without delay attend to any type of indicators of problem. Sneaky Home Invaders



While you might be diligent in maintaining your home tidy and organized, sneaky home invaders can still discover their method unnoticed. These parasites are masters of hiding in ordinary view, making it critical to remain attentive in identifying their presence.

Right here are a few sly home invaders you should keep an eye out for:

1. ** Silverfish **: These tiny, silvery bugs love moist, dark rooms like cellars and bathrooms. They feed upon starchy products and can create damage to publications, wallpaper, and apparel.

2. ** Carpet Beetles **: Typically incorrect for safe ladybugs, carpeting beetles can ruin your home. Their larvae feed upon natural fibers like wool and silk, triggering irreversible damage to carpetings, garments, and upholstery.

3. ** Earwigs **: Despite their ominous-looking pincers, earwigs are even more of a problem than a danger. They're drawn in to wetness and can discover their method into your home with splits and holes. Watch out for them in wet locations like kitchens and bathrooms.
